Which role does Debora Borgas hold?

Explanation:
The key idea is the person who shapes how staff are trained and supported—the Director of Training and Staff Development. This role is responsible for designing and delivering onboarding and ongoing training, identifying learning needs, and assessing the effectiveness of programs to ensure staff competence and policy compliance. Debora Borgas is noted as holding this position, which aligns with duties centered on training and professional development rather than daily operations of security, facility administration, or executive leadership. The other roles—Warden (facility head), Chief of Security (security operations leader), and Deputy Director (second-in-command)—focus on broader management or specific security responsibilities, not on training programs.
